  • Private Party Facilities: The Tasting Room is the accidentally discovered downstairs room at 569 Hudson Street, home to Philip Marie Restaurant. The private "Tasting Room" dining space started its life as an 18th century farm house kitchen. It was walled up and built over for more than a century until John rediscovered it, giving back its sense of purpose. Local lore has it that, in the late 1700's, the kitchen was the centerpiece of a loving couples home. Its dual hearths kept the lovers and the community warm and nourished. Once again, parties of 4 to 20 may experience exceptional dining, choosing from a customized menu, served in the very same kitchen the original residents cherished.

About Our Executive Chef & Owner

John P. Greco III is well known throughout the restaurant communitiesof New York, Rome, Milan, Frankfurt and Brazil. He is a graduate of the Culinary Institute of America. Before opening Philip Marie, he worked at such renowned establishments as San Domenico, NYC & Imola, Italy, Cipriani/Harry's Bar, NYC & Venice, Le Cirque, NYC and Torre di Pisa in New York, where he was executive chef. With classical training and broad experience, Greco's love of American Heartland preparations has inspired his creative take on good ol' American food.
